Rise of the Tomb Raider Will Let Players ‘Compete With Their Friends,’ But We Don’t Know Exactly How Yet

While it was earlier stated that the upcoming Rise of the Tomb Raider would not have any kind of multiplayer functionality, instead focusing on Lara’s second adventure, it appears that was not entirely true- Microsoft confirmed to VideoGamer.com that Rise of the Tomb Raider will have some form of multiplayer functionality, though they neglected to elaborate any further.

“Crystal Dynamics are hard at work on Rise of the Tomb Raider and excited to deliver an amazing experience on Nov. 10 (US, 13, Nov. UK),” Microsoft said. “In the coming weeks and months, stay tuned for more info on all things Rise of the Tomb Raider – including how players will be able to extend their single-player campaign and compete with their friends.”

This could very well be referring to, for instance, leaderboards that pit players against each other- which would be passive and asynchronous multiplayer functionality that would still be in line with the earlier statement.

Guess we will just have to wait for an update from Microsoft for now.

Rise of the Tomb Raider launches on Xbox 360 and Xbox one this November.
